WebTable of Contents. latest MMEditing 社区. 贡献代码; 生态项目(待更新) WebJan 28, 2024 · The recommended way to build tensors in Pytorch is to use the following two factory functions: torch.tensor and torch.as_tensor. torch.tensor always copies the data. For example, torch.tensor(x) is equivalent to x.clone().detach(). torch.as_tensor always tries to avoid copies of the data. One of the cases where as_tensor avoids copying the …

I read my data in as follows: emnist = scipy.io.loadmat(DATA_DIR + '/emnist-letters.mat') WebIf the self Tensor already has the correct torch.dtype and torch.device, then self is returned. Otherwise, the returned tensor is a copy of self with the desired torch.dtype and torch.device. Here are the ways to call to: to(dtype, non_blocking=False, copy=False, memory_format=torch.preserve_format) → Tensor

WebMar 24, 2024 · np_img = np.random.randint (low=0, high=255, size= (32, 32, 1), dtype=np.uint8) # np_img.shape == (32, 32, 1) pil_img = Image.fromarray (np_img) will raise TypeError: Cannot handle this data type: (1, 1, 1), u1 Solution: If the image shape is like (32, 32, 1), reduce dimension into (32, 32)
